These wavelength sensitive, filter type attenuators induce a fixed value loss between two connectors. When introduced into a fiber optic link , the attenuator will weaken the strength of the optical signal. This loss or "attenuation" is needed when an optical signal has too much power which exceeds the dynamic range of the receiver. (read more)
Fiber optic attenuators are devices that reduce signal power in fiber optic links by inducing a fixed or variable loss.
